Ensuring the Safety of Our Military Aviators Act of 2017
This bill prohibits the Department of Defense from approving any application for the construction or alteration of a wind turbine that is proposed to be constructed or altered within 25 miles of a military airbase or military airfield.

A BILL
A bill to limit the construction or alterations of wind turbines near a
military airbase or military airfield.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,
S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.
This Act may be cited as the ``Ensuring the Safety of Our Military
Aviators Act of 2017''.
SEC. 2. PROHIBITION OF CERTAIN WIND TURBINE PROJECTS.
Notwithstanding any other provision of law or any determination by
the Secretary of Transportation, the Secretary of Defense shall not
approve any application for the construction or alteration of a wind
turbine if such turbine is proposed to be constructed or altered within
25 miles of a military airbase or military airfield.
